Want to know who'll be selecting the winners of the Amarula Best Retreats in Africa Awards? Here are the judges? but don't forget we need you to be a judge in the Consumer Choice Award!

Christa Nel
Now Senior Project manager on Explore SA Magazine, it was working on Southern Sun?s Equinox Magazine that fuelled her interest in tourism. In 2004 she became marketing consultant on Explore SA. The team has since won a Pica Award for the Best Business-to-Business Magazine in Travel.

Didi Moyle
Didi is acting CEO of SA Tourism and has served on its executive for six years. She has a B Soc Sc Hons in Political Science (UND) and Clinical Psychology (UCT). She was the Deputy Editor of Femina magazine before moving into government.

Etienne Bruwer
Etienne is a tourism expert with an in-depth understanding of in-bound and out-bound travel. As Amarula Tourism Activation Manager, he is driving Amarula?s sponsorship of the Best Retreats in Africa Awards, to celebrate and champion the Best of Africa.

Isabel Carstens
Managing Director of the Isa Carstens Health and Skin Care Academy, Isabel is a board member of the South Africa Association of Health and Skin Care Professionals and acts as international examiner for CIDESCO. She was awarded the CIDESCO Medal Merite for professionalism.

Jennifer Seif
Executive Director of Fair Trade in Tourism South Africa (FTTSA), a position she has held for eight years. Currently completing her Ph.D. at the University of Pretoria, focusing on Tourism Certification and Destination Competitiveness.

Joanne Adolphe
General Manager Product Development of Thompsons Holidays. Has been with the company for 12 years. Joanne is responsible for the Product Department and oversees the procurement and packaging of their wonderful holiday destinations.

Katherine Joyce
Director, The Business For WellnessTM, Katherine joined the Board of Directors in 2007. She is committed to exceptional service delivery and has a wealth of experience in process management, finance and the wellness industry.

Llewellyn van Wyk
A Founder Member of both the Green Building Council of SA, and the 2004 Cape Town Olympic Bid. His architectural practice, has completed over 300 buildings in Southern Africa. In 1984 he became a Cape Town City Councillor.

Mega Abodedele
Mega left London?s South Bank University (B Sc Hons in Social Science), and worked in social care for 10 years. He then produced BEN TV on Sky and now produces Africa Awakes, highlighting Africa?s opportunities.

Richard Holmes
Travel Editor of iafrica.com and a freelance journalist, Richard is as happy in a cottage in the Cederberg as he is lapping up Hong Kong, but when it comes to escaping his inbox he reckons you can?t beat a hide-away in the Cape mountains.

Sharon van Wyk
This award-winning freelance journalist specialises in travel, tourism, and conservation. Sharon has worked closely with Fair Trade in Tourism SA and edits the Mail & Guardian?s supplement dedicated to the NGO?s work.

Stephan Antoni
Multi-Award winning architect Stefan Antoni established his cutting-edge architectural practice in 1987. The practice has carved a niche for itself locally and internationally for stylish, sensual and powerful design.

Pam Nel
A registered Assessor with the South African Tourism Grading Council, Pam is a Hospitality Consultant, Freelance Caterer and Building Project manager. She also wrote her own cookbook, ?Hot Food from a Cool Kitchen.?

Shannon Smith
Shannon was a make-up artist in Cape Town and Europe before settling in South Africa. As Fairlady?s Beauty Editor Shannon was nominated for two Mondi Awards for Excellence in Journalism and the Media24 Excellence Award.

Sindiswa Nhlumayo
The Deputy Director General for The Department of Environmental Affairs and Tourism, Sindiswa helps to provide leadership in the development and implementation of policies and strategies designed to grow tourism in South Africa.

Talia Sanhwe
As an anchor for CNBC Africa, Talia is a skilled communicator with a warm, professional approach. She has worked for the BBC World Service and CNN in London. On TV she has worked on Top Billing and been a producer/presenter on SAfm.

Mandy Mankazana
Born in Soweto, Mandy founded IMBIZO Tours and is the first black woman Tour Operator in SA. She had wide experience in show business before seeing tourism as the platform to tell her story of the old and new South Africa.

Margot Janse
The incredibly creative Executive Chef at the award winning, Relais and Chateaux Le Quartier Francais Hotel in Franschhoek. She has received countless acco- lades from the world?s most respected publications.

Jenny Morris Jenny Morris - AKA The Giggling Gourmet - is one of SA's most-loved food personalities. An author, writer, radio and TV presenter, celebrity chef, teacher, caterer and culinary tour guide, she has had an ongoing love affair with food since childhood. Her catering company, the Giggling Gourmet is in demand, and Jenny teaches practical hands-on cooking courses at her cooking school, The CooksPlayground?

Jenny makes regular appearances around and outside the country, and is often commissioned by leading brands for recipe and menu development. She is an examiner for The Culinary Academy, a judge for various food competitions, and is in regular demand as the first choice SA Celebrity Chef to make appearances at various functions and product launches.

She has cooked for dozens of royals and celebrities, including Prince Charles, Thabo Mbeki, Kenneth Kaunda, Charlize Theron, and Al Gore, yet remains stoically down to earth. When she's not wowing the public she will be in her kitchen stirring a pot of something fragrant and delicious.

Jenny can be heard on radio 567 CapeTalk and Radio 702 in Johannesburg.
